Burrows et al. [30] CS 667 adolescents (♀ 47.8%; ♂ 52.2%) 16.8 ± 0.3 Chile NA NA DXA Fasting glucose; TG; HDL-C; WC; BP; adiponectin; hs-CRP. HOMA-IR (n = 558) (n = 109) Adolescents with IR had significantly lower (p < 0.001) mean values of LM (%). Independently significant association between IR and sarcopenia (OR: 4.9; 95% CI: 3.2–7.5)
